A frequent source of trouble during the 1xbet download is device compatibility. Before initiating the download, it’s essential to verify if your device meets the minimum system requirements specified by 1xbet. For Android users, the app typically requires a version 5.0 (Lollipop) or higher, while iOS users need iOS 9.0 or above. If your device runs on an outdated operating system, the download may fail or the app might not function properly after installation.
Device storage is another crucial factor. Insufficient storage space can interrupt the download or cause the app to crash. Ensuring you have at least 100MB of free space is advisable for a smooth installation. Additionally, some devices block app installations from unknown sources (Android) by default. You need to enable installation permissions in your device settings to allow the 1xbet APK to be downloaded and installed successfully.
A common culprit behind slow or incomplete downloads is unstable internet connectivity. Downloading the 1xbet app requires a reliable and sufficiently fast internet connection. Interruptions or weak signals can cause the download process to pause or fail altogether. Wi-Fi is usually the preferred choice for downloading apps to avoid excessive data charges and ensure faster transfer speeds 1xbet app.
If you notice the download is stuck or progressing very slowly, try restarting your router or switching to another network. Mobile data connections may suffer from bandwidth limits or intermittent coverage, so monitoring your connection quality is essential. In some cases, clearing your browser’s cache or trying a different browser may also improve download speeds if you are accessing the app download page through a web browser.

After downloading the 1xbet app, some users might experience trouble during installation or face app crashes when trying to open the app. Installation errors often result from corrupted APK files or conflicts with existing apps.
If an error pops up during installation, first delete the downloaded file and try downloading it again, as the previous file might have been corrupted. Next, check for any software updates on your device, as outdated system software can cause compatibility issues. Sometimes, clearing cache and data of your device’s package installer or restarting your phone can help resolve the error. If the app crashes repeatedly, uninstalling and reinstalling the app or clearing the app cache through your device settings can often resolve performance glitches.
Device security settings sometimes block app installations from outside official app stores, which is a primary hurdle for users downloading 1xbet directly from the website. On Android, the “Unknown sources” permission must be enabled to install APK files. Depending on your Android version, this permission might be under “Install unknown apps” or “Security” settings.
Aside from enabling installation from unknown sources, the app requires certain permissions once installed, such as access to storage and location. Denying these permissions might prevent the app from functioning properly. To avoid this, carefully review app permission requests when launching 1xbet for the first time, and grant the necessary access to enjoy all features without interruptions.
